Southern Comfort Runs Big Easy Summer Promotion

Southern Comfort brings its "let the good times roll" attitude to consumers with its Big Easy Summer promotional campaign.

The campaign uses the vibrant artwork of Matt Rinard, a New Orleans artist, in p.o.s. materials featuring the season's tastiest cocktails-Southern Lemonade and Southern Hurricane.

Featured elements of the off-premise campaign include a New Orleans streetlight, case cards with recipe tear-pads featuring the Southern Lemonade, pennant streamers, and a bright summer guide that provides recipes and summer event dates. Southern Comfort, a whisky, fruit and spice-flavored liqueur, was founded in New Orleans by bartender M.W. Heron in 1874.


Nike Golf Conducts National CPR Tour

Nike Golf is bringing the ease and enjoyment of its CPR hybrids-Clubs for Prevention and Recovery-to golfers around the country through a mobile tour visiting on-course and off-course locations throughout the country through mid-September.

Three Nike Golf-CPR ambulances will make stops at golf courses, practice facilities and off-course golf specialty shops. At each stop, Nike Golf's CPR medics will introduce golfers to the full line of CPR woods, CPR iron-woods and the new CPR mixed set.

Golfers will have the opportunity to demo and purchase every club in the line. Nike Golf staff will be on hand to write CPR prescriptions that will remedy any ill conditions golfers have been experiencing on the golf course. Additionally, the entire line of Nike Golf equipment will be available during the demo experience.

Combination CompUSA/Good Guys Stores To Open In California

CompUSA announced the next steps in its retail strategy concerning Good Guys, a high-end home electronic chain acquired by the company in 2003. Plans include combination CompUSA/Good Guys stores in California by converting 14 Good Guys retail locations and 3 current CompUSA locations. These new stores are designed to meet the increasingly diverse buying needs of customers wanting more choice by offering them a mix of both CompUSA and Good Guys merchandise.

"Product and technology convergence is continually increasing and customers are looking for answers," said Larry Mondry, CompUSA CEO. "Our new combination unleashes the power of technology for our customers through a broader range of products, and unmatched expertise from our CompUSA and Good Guys' highly trained and technology-savvy staff."

Mondry added that in addition to the store-level changes, the CompUSA merchandising department has joined forces with the Good Guys buying and merchandising team. This newly formed department will provide the best selection of products available, capitalizing on the expertise and buying power of both teams.


Jason's Deli Completes Nation's Largest Anti-Trans Fat Project

After a painstaking five-year mission, every food item in all of Jason's Deli's 137 restaurants nationwide is completely free of partially hydrogenated oils. Jason's also supplies one million box lunches served each year to elementary and secondary school students. All items in those box lunches are now free of partially hydrogenated oils. The new Dietary Guidelines issued by the U.S. Government state that we should keep trans fat consumption "as low as possible."

In changing its entire menu and every product it serves, Jason's had to use its purchasing power to push its suppliers to change their ways. Jason's R&D department worked intensively on the project. Once it found or developed a product without partially hydrogenated oil, it was tried in Jason's 16 test delis for customer tasting and comments. In all, Jason's Deli converted 47 ingredients once made with partially hydrogenated oils, which go into making many of its 80 standard menu items.

Outwater Plastics Relocates Corporate Headquarters

Outwater Plastics has relocated its corporate headquarters to Bogota, New Jersey, situated approximately five miles from New York City. The new, state-of-the-art 250,000+ square foot facility accommodates Outwater Plastics Industries' and Architectural Products by Outwater's sales and warehouse facilities as well as a new showroom, all under one roof. Trion Industries' new ScanLock is an easy-to-use, inexpensive key lock system that secures most common scan hooks and even retrofits existing hooks in place. It is a low cost anti-theft solution and can be integrated into existing planograms, unlike other hook locks. It provides simple swing-aside access to items; no need to remove the lock to sell product. Placed far forward, it prevents the removal of any product, or it can be set to display 1-2 items unlocked for easy customer access, while the balance of stock is locked and held secure preventing mass theft and "sweeping." ScanLock relocks without a key in the tumbler. An optional security plate works with most metal and plastic backplate designs to provide additional theft deterrence in high-risk environments. Sal Cavallaro, CME, Chairman of the Trade Show Exhibitors Association’s Board of Directors, has announced the appointment of Stephen Schuldenfrei as President of TSEA. Cavallaro said, “TSEA’s Board of Directors believes that Steve will carry forward TSEA’s commitment to servicing the exhibition and event marketing community.” Schuldenfrei brings an extensive background both with trade shows and association management. He previously was Executive Director of the Society of Independent Show Organizers (SISO) and President of the Exposition Operations Society (EOS).

A Team Retained For Upcoming Marketing Campaigns

The A Team, a marketing and promotions agency headquartered in midtown Manhattan, has been retained by three new clients-The Food Emporium, Ricola USA and The Spice Hunter, for campaigns in 2005.

On behalf of the Food Emporium, The A Team will handle the introduction for its online grocery service. For Ricola USA, the agency will manage promotions for the 2005 cough/cold season. The A Team's Irvine, CA office recently won The Spice Hunter account, and will be handling the Company's retailer programs.
